On today's incredible episode, I'm speaking with the talented Todd Schmenk, author of …

Team Positive: How to Build Support for Someone Coping with a Chronic Illness

Todd is a licensed mental health counselor with over twenty years of experience in the mental and behavioral health field helping patients work through chronic health, anxiety, and adjustment issues. His private practice, AQAL Therapies, is located in Providence, Rhode Island.

Todd is adept in using Acceptance and Commitment Therapy (ACT), Solution-Focused Brief Therapy (SFBT), and advanced Integral Psychotherapy (IP) methodologies to facilitate client awareness and emotional flexibility driven by values-based, client-centered, and solution-focused strategies.

He has been honored with an innovative health promotion award from the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ention; listed as one of the best three marriage counselors in Rhode Island two years in a row, and has completed the Certified Integral Therapist yearlong training program. He has a Master of Education, Community Health from Cleveland State University, a Master of Science in Clinical Mental Health Counseling from Walden University, and is a Licensed Mental Health Counselor in Rhode Island.

He is an inaugural member of the Integral Institute, the American Mental Health Counselors Association, the Association of Contextual and Behavioral Science, the American Counseling Association, and sits on the board of the Rhode Island Mental Health Counselors Association.

Todd is also a captivating public speaker with more than fifteen years of expertise educating various populations (both public and professional) on mental health and wellness topics utilizing enthusiasm, storytelling, and technology in delivering memorable speeches and presentations.

Todd and his wife, Beth, have made a habit of consistently doing activities together with their love of dancing and teaching Lindy Hop, Balboa, and the Charleston, going on long hiking trips and traveling, kayaking, and now in working together on creating this book. They live in Rhode Island with their two cats.
